Chinese shares open mixed Wednesday

Xinhua,January 17, 2018 Adjust font size:

BEIJING, Jan. 17 (Xinhua) -- Chinese stocks opened mixed on Wednesday, with the benchmark Shanghai Composite Index up 0.06 percent to open at 3,438.58 points.

The Shenzhen Component Index opened 0.18 percent lower at 11,366.6 points. Enditem
